Grand Re-Opening October 5, 2007 More than two years after Hurricane Katrina reduced it to rubble, the Martin Luther King Jr. Branch returned triumphantly to its home in the Lower Ninth Ward's Martin Luther King Jr. Charter School for Science and Technology. |
